EXAMPLE Of SINGAPORES KNOWLEDGE
BASED ECONOMY
Total export volume 563 billion $
113 million $ Investment by ROCHE , in biomedical research
450 million $ investment in Robotics
3 universities in top 20 ranking of world universities
The country works to develop all related elements: finance and venture capital;
project management; technology transfer; skills; regulation; and so on.
collaboration between all parities of investment but central foundation is talent
pool

INTIATIVES OF CURRENT GOVERMENT
Planning of state of the art Lahore Knowledge Park project worth 1billion
dollar which will produce
a) about 11200 PhDs
b) 40000 jobs
c)172 billion Rs. Revenue will be generated
Functionalization of Arfa Kareem Software Technology Park
Development of e-learning initiative of Punjab government in Public schools,
to make learning and monitoring process more effective.
Use of ICT in computerization of different departments
